logo

Output ff53fc2d31fb69d181292f6c97d37757fc448a6bd6bedbaad9d19762165d5568:1

value
17303554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b53ecfd0e4e6bc3e22bd59a9bf25f37557ff44e OP_EQUAL
address
3EPiPUFFhq2wvN1xmVrYsaCZyFqzsw7RNg
transaction
ff53fc2d31fb69d181292f6c97d37757fc448a6bd6bedbaad9d19762165d5568